Leonard Maltin Biography

Birth Name:Leonard Maltin

Birth Place:New York City, New York, United States

Profession Actor, Writer, Producer

Fast Facts

  • Became president of the Los Angeles Film Critics Association in the mid-1990s
  • After beginning his film critiquing career at the age of 15 with the creation of his own film magazine, Maltin went on to earn a journalism degree and write for major magazines like Variety and TV Guide
  • Best known for his long-time role of film critic on the series "Entertainment Tonight․"
  • Regarded for his film expertise and authoring several successful books on cinema and its history
  • Worked as a film critic for Playboy magazine for six years
  • According to the Guinness Book of World Records, he wrote the world's shortest movie review; it is for the musical "Isn't It Romantic?" starring Veronica Lake and consists of only the word "No․"
